Emails between Geelong Cats, AFL at the centre of club’s defence
P
Peter Ryan, Jake Niall, Sam McClure, Daniel Brettig✦AI Summary
The Geelong Cats are defending their handling of a player concussion agreement by citing email correspondence with the AFL. The club admits the document was not properly lodged and contained an inappropriate waiver, but maintains the league was aware of the negotiations.
